Pablo B. Quintana, "Ke-Sto-We" (one who carries arrows), was born in 1947 into the Cochiti Pueblo. He was inspired to become an artist by admiring his aunt, Helen Cordero. Pablo specializes in hand-made micacious clay sculptures, which include storytellers, angels, and nativities. Pablo signs his pottery as : Pablo Quintana, Cochiti, NM. Pablo is related to the following artists: Liz Baca-quintana(sister), Vangie Suina (niece), the famous Dena Suina (niece). This is a one of akind item. This storyteller is 5 1/2" x 4".
